DependencyDependency
A generic term for children living in “out-of-home” care
Youth living in foster homes, group homes, relative care, institutions, or with their birth families under supervision
Overseen by the government; may be contracted out
Youth usually have history of child abuse, neglect or abandonment

Basic Facts about Foster Care
Basic Facts about Foster Care
Number of children• 520,000 in the United States• 30,000 in Florida• 5000 in Miami-Dade County
Average length of stay • 3 years for all youth in foster care • 6 years for youth who turn 18 while in care
- Casey Family Programs

Negative Outcomes Negative Outcomes
50-60% do not graduate from high school.
25% of prison population were in foster youth.
25% of youth who “age out” of foster care are homeless within 12-18 months.
34% end up on welfare.
20% of females give birth shortly after leaving care.
